    Taken from Private eye - Gravy train restarts...

    "EMPLOYMENT secretary Thérèse Coffey is to tackle the looming unemployment crisis by reviving a privatised “welfare-to-work” scheme from 2011 that was marred by poor results, corruption, exploitation of the unemployed and the collapse of leading providers.

    Under Coffey's £2.9bn Restart scheme, contractors will help unemployed people who have been on Universal Credit for more than a year into work using job coaches, training and work placements, on a paid-by-results basis.

    This seems very similar to the Work Programme, set up under the coalition
    after the economic crisis and judged by the National Audit Office to have had a “poor start" and performed "less than(the) original forecast".

    Bids for 12 regional “packages” are being invited from 14 companies on a pre-approved list, implying less-than-fierce competition among some familiar firms - including Serco, Capita and G4S, all of which have already cashed in on
    Covid-19 contracts with varied success. Also on the list is People Plus Group, a company formed out of the scandal-hit A4e, and Maximus, the US firm which runs much-criticised disability benefit evaluations. No worries there, then"
